Ronan Farrow said Thursday that he and “at least one other prominent journalist” who had reported on the National Enquirer and President Donald Trump received blackmail threats from the tabloid’s parent company, American Media Inc., over their work. Farrow’s allegation came just hours after Amazon chief executive Jeff Bezos published a remarkable public post accusing the National Enquirer of attempting to extort and blackmail him by threatening to publish intimate photos unless he stopped investigating the publication. I and at least one other prominent journalist involved in breaking stories about the National Enquirer’s arrangement with Trump fielded similar “stop digging or we’ll ruin you” blackmail efforts from AMI. (I did not engage as I don’t cut deals with subjects of ongoing reporting.) The relationship between the National Enquirer and Trump has been repeatedly scrutinized by the media, given the president’s long friendship with AMI chief executive David Pecker.
